Over the
last few weeks, we have exposed four confirmed infiltrators who have
tried to integrate themselves into our organizing. These are people who
were working with James O’Keefe and Project Veritas. We must make this
clear: These groups are doing the dirty work of Nazis, white
nationalists, and other groups who are furthering Trump’s assault on
vulnerable communities.

Two infiltrators appeared at
an antifascist organizing meeting and immediately fell under suspicion
due to their vague backstories, poor education about our movement, and
unusual dress. Social media checks showed that one, Tarah. Tarah, who
called herself “Tarah,” was a failed actress who was friends on Facebook
with James O’Keefe.

One of these infiltrators was
someone calling himself “Tyler.” Due to suspicions, the organizers
initiated their vetting process with a false flag operation. Our allies
at the DC Antifascist Coalition met with Tyler. Because they thought it
would be a humorous venue, they arranged to meet with Tyler at Comet
Ping Pong, which has recently been targeted by right-wing fake news
outlets. Though the coalition members did not know who he was working
for, they knew Tyler was not who he said he was. So, they met in advance
of their meeting with Tyler, and planned to gave him false information
about the what they felt was the most humorous red herring available: a
false plot to use stink bombs at an event called the Deploraball with
the so-called “Alt Right.” Tyler, as it turned out, was recording a
video for Project Veritas.

False plans were
discussed with Tyler. They spoke of false plans in order to protect
themselves, and did not discuss any real intentions. It is laughable
that Project Veritas believes that organizers would discuss secret
“stink bomb’ plans with an unknown individual in a public venue. Project
Veritas’ lack of judgement portrays the poor quality of their work.

The group had however purchased tickets to the Deploraball for the purpose of video taping.

“The
group had no intention of causing any damage or disruption at the
Deploraball,” said one of our organizers, who appears in the Veritas
video. “Instead, the intent was to capture on video any compromising
moments from the performers or speakers, such as the Nazi salutes that
similar groups gave in November, broadcast widely by The Atlantic.”

Other
infiltrators include Marissa, who, using her real first name, appeared
at a small planning meeting on Saturday, January 7, with brown hair and
all-American demeanor. Then the same woman appeared with dyed neon red
hair and heavy gothic makeup to our DisruptJ20 Action Camp on Saturday,
January 14. She was recognized immediately and promptly escorted away
from the event.

At every meeting, we reaffirm our
commitment to not harming anyone. We stand by our principles and are
committed to building the broadest possible resistance to Trump’s
agenda.
